About COHR Coherent Corp.

Coherent Corp is a vertically integrated manufacturing company that develops, manufactures, and markets lasers, transceivers, and other optical and optoelectronic devices, modules, and systems, as well as engineered materials, for use in the communications, industrial, instrumentation, and electronics markets. Its reporting segments are Datacenter Communications and Industrial. Its geographic areas are North America, Europe, China, Japan, and the rest of the world.

About BSBR Banco Santander Brasil SA each representing one unit

Banco Santander (Brasil) SA is part of Santander Group, a Spanish bank. It operates across two segments; the Commercial Banking segment, catering to both individual and corporate client and the Global Wholesale Banking segment, which encompasses Investment Banking and Markets operations, including the Treasury and Equity Business Departments. The bank generates majority of its revenue from the Commercial Banking segment and has operations in Brazil and internationally.
